On December 9th, 2015, the former Suffolk County Chief of Police James Burke is arrested for assaulting Chris Loeb three years earlier. Back in December 2012, Chris stole several items from Burke’s police vehicle, including a black duffel bag with an alleged homemade snuff film inside of it. Concerned that Chris would reveal the contents of his duffel bag, Burke struck Chris repeatedly and threatened to kill him. In November 2016, Burke is sentenced to 46 months in prison for his crimes. But, during the investigation of Burke, more of his corruption was revealed. From January 2012 to October 2015, Burke single-handedly slowed the progress of the Long Island Serial Killer case. He shut out the FBI, forced out detectives on the case, and stopped the searches for more victims.
